ATTACK AT ALICANTE

BRITISH SHIP BOMBED WHILE UNLOADING VESSEL SET ON FIRE. ARAB SEAMAN KILLED. By Telegraph—Press Association. Copyright. (Recd This Day, 10.10 a.m.) LONDON, September 6. The British ship Marvia was bombed while unloading at Alicante, and set on fire. An Arab sailor was killed.
